关于两个球体在Stokes流中解的收敛性问题

摘    要:Stokes流绕两个球体流动问题是3连通域的外流问题。此问题的解是由一系列调和函数和双调和函数项的级数表达式线形组合而成。文中探讨这些表达式在两个球体接触情况下的收敛性问题。通过收敛性的判断得出了当一个球体向另一个平面接近时,这些解中的系数的级数表达式不收敛;而当两个球体互相接近甚至接触时,其解中的系数的级数表达式收敛。这就为流场中物体的相互接触问题的进一步研究打下了基础。

On convergence of series expressions of the solution to a Stokes flow around two spherical bodies

Abstract:The investigation of the Stokes flow around two spherical solids is involved in that of the outer flow of the connected regions. The complete solution for the problem is made up of the series expressions of which all terms take the form of harmonics or biharmonics. This paper will discuss the convergence of these series expressions especially when the two spheres are at contact. Using the convergence criterions dealing with the series, it is found that in the case of a sphere approaching a plane, the summation of the corrective coefficients in every series expression becomes divergent, but the summation for the case of two touching spheres is convergent even when the two spheres come into contact. This conclusion lays the foundation for the further investigation of the dynamical process in the case of two bodies in contact.
